Suppliers of carbon-neutral components are in a strong position as environmentally friendly material innovation spearheads the vehicle production process with an increasing focus on cabin interiors.

The automotive industry is witnessing unprecedented levels of disruption and innovation, and rapidly evolving technological advances are impacting all areas of the vehicle, notably interiors. Additionally, by improving the “circular economy,” automakers and suppliers are seeking to create sustainable vehicle interiors. Furthermore, strict government laws and policies requiring ethical extraction practices to accommodate customers' shifting lifestyle preferences are increasing eco-friendly product development. This carbon-neutral initiative has led to growing demand for OEMs to implement materials with the least harmful environmental impact.
